libexif 0.6.21-2+deb9u1 contains five security vulnerabilities currently marked
as "no DSA".

The attached debdiff fixes these vulnerabilities.

CVE-2020-12767 - division-by-zero errors
CVE-2020-0093  - read buffer overflow
CVE-2018-20030 - denial of service by wasting CPU
CVE-2017-7544  - out-of-bounds heap read
CVE-2016-6328  - integer overflow

+From: Dan Fandrich <d...@coneharvesters.com>
+Date: Fri, 12 Oct 2018 16:01:45 +0200
+Subject: Improve deep recursion detection in exif_data_load_data_content.
+Origin: 
https://github.com/libexif/libexif/commit/6aa11df549114ebda520dde4cdaea2f9357b2c89
+Bug-Debian-Security: https://security-tracker.debian.org/tracker/CVE-2018-20030
+Bug-Debian: https://bugs.debian.org/918730
+
+The existing detection was still vulnerable to pathological cases
+causing DoS by wasting CPU. The new algorithm takes the number of tags
+into account to make it harder to abuse by cases using shallow recursion
+but with a very large number of tags.  This improves on commit 5d28011c
+which wasn't sufficient to counter this kind of case.
+
+The limitation in the previous fix was discovered by Laurent Delosieres,
+Secunia Research at Flexera (Secunia Advisory SA84652) and is assigned
+the identifier CVE-2018-20030.
